
7 March 2005
DSD OPENS FOYLE STREET SITE TO FUN FAIR
DSD’s North West Development Office has made the former City Hotel site in Foyle Street available to Cullen’s Amusements to operate a fun fair from 11 to 20 March 2005.
The site was repossessed by DSD in January following a protracted legal battle in the High Court and Lands Tribunal. A Developer’s Brief is expected to be issued in the near future.
In the meantime, however, during the forthcoming St Patrick’s Day celebrations the site will host a fun fair and contribute to the carnival atmosphere in the city centre.
The Director of the North West Development Office, Declan O’Hare, said: "Our city centre has too often been the subject of negative publicity. We need to address this and create a safe, family-friendly city centre where people can meet, interact and enjoy a wide range of attractions. To do so will require an integrated response from a number of agencies given the inter-related issues involved. In the short term we can be creative in using our assets whenever possible to promote a positive and welcoming image of the city centre. The fun fair is a family friendly attraction and will bring life, if only for a short period, to a site that has lain empty for years."
Mr Joe Cullen, of Cullen’s Amusements, welcomed DSD’s co-operation. He said: "The Foyle Street site is the perfect place to locate our amusement fun fair. As a local business we have been seeking to participate in Festival events for many years. We are delighted that thanks to DSD we can now contribute to the St Patrick’s March Celebrations and Festival in Derry by providing a fun day out for all the family in the city centre."
